Emergency
press and hold this key to enter emergency mode . When
the transceiver enters Emergency mode, it will change to
the emergency channel and begin transmitting based on
your dealer settings .
Note:
this function can be programmed only on the auxiliary
key .
n
Key lock
press this key to lock and unlock the transceiver keys .
While key lock is activated, you cannot use the Auxiliary,
Side 1
, Side 2, and microphone pF keys .
Note:
You can still use the following key functions when Key
lock is activated: emergency, lone Worker, monitor, monitor
momentary, squelch off, squelch off momentary, key lock,
ptt + autodial, ptt + 2-tone .
n
lone Worker
press this key to toggle the lone Worker function on or
oFF . if the transceiver is not operated for the
pre-programmed time, it will emit a Lone Worker tone.
Subsequently, if no operation is performed while the tone is
emitted, the transceiver will enter Emergency mode.
n
low Transmit Power
Press this key to change the transmit power on the current
channel to low power, to conserve battery energy.
n
Monitor
press this key to deactivate qt or dqt signaling . press
this key again to return to normal operation .
